Полезная информация

Будьте в курсе последних изменений в мире Mozilla, следя за нашим микроблогом в Twitter.

Сustom Buttons » Custom Buttons » 22-08-2007 17:20:19

благодарю )

Однако я нашел еще более изощренное решение :

Выделить код

Код:

function yo()
{
var path='c:\\windows\\notepad.exe';
var arguments=['c:\\aa.txt'];

var file = Components.classes['@mozilla.org/file/local;1']
.createInstance(Components.interfaces.nsILocalFile);
var process = Components.classes['@mozilla.org/process/util;1']
.getService(Components.interfaces.nsIProcess);
file.initWithPath(path);
process.init(file);
process.run(false,arguments,arguments.length);
}

yo();

:)

Сustom Buttons » Custom Buttons » 21-08-2007 23:29:19

привет, может кто знает, почему этот код не робит:

Выделить код

Код:

var path='c:\\windows\\notepad.exe';
var arguments=['c:\\aa.txt'];

var file = Components.classes['@mozilla.org/file/local;1']
.createInstance(Components.interfaces.nsILocalFile);
var process = Components.classes['@mozilla.org/process/util;1']
.getService(Components.interfaces.nsIProcess);
file.initWithPath(path);
process.init(file);
process.run(false,arguments,arguments.length);

Вставляю его в code и по нажатию на кнопку ни чего не происходит, однако в initalization он срабатывает :(

Board footer

Powered by PunBB
Modified by Mozilla Russia
Copyright © 2004–2011 Mozilla Russia
Язык отображения форума: [Русский] [English]